I lost 90% investing in Citigroup. Invested based on a analyst recommendation. Later the big banking crash happened, and I lost most of my Citigroup stock. I assumed the government woudl bail them out if things went south (and they did!)...what I didn't realize is they woudl demand a massive equity stake. Thankfully, it wasn't a large % of my portfolio...but lesson learned. Never invest in banking stocks.
More recently, I got hammered with VITL (natural/organic eggs). Got wiped out 70%. Lesson learned this time...be careful about investing in commodities when a competitor ($CALM) is accelerating capex. Basically $CALM just flooded the market with specialty eggs and they cracked VITL..and I'm not sure they'll ever recover.
